A 7470Includes mixed residential and commercial property within the affordable home ownership program

Congress · introduced 2025-03-28

Includes mixed residential and commercial property within the provisions of the affordable home ownership development program thus authorizing the affordable housing corporation to fund the construction or rehabilitation of housing that also contains a commercial retailing business.
